There is but, if I recall correctly, the color coding can conflict with any other kind of delta shading you have going on. I'm currently in the process of trying to migrate my charts from ATAS to MW so I'll have to deal with that myself pretty soon. I suggest trying to make transparent bars on a black background with white number fonts and then coloring red/green (or blue/green if you are colorblind) for the imbalances. The settings, if I recall correctly, are split between the Bid X Ask tab and the Imbalance tab (for the Volume Imprint study, which is what Footprints are called in MW).

On the off chance you were using a stacked imbalance indicator on a regular candlestick chart; I don't think MW has an indicator for that. You need the footprint chart.
